Stable Value vs. Money Market
Most U.S. retirement plans offer participants an investment alternative designed to provide capital preservation. Both money market and stable value funds fit this objective as they allow invested capital to remain daily liquid, earn a market-determined rate of interest, and remain at a fixed net asset value (NAV).
